Portugal Cimpor 2007 Profit up 4.2% YoY
27 March 2008


Cimpor has posted a consolidated net profit of EUR304.1m for 2007, which was a 4.2 per cent YoY rise, the company said in a note to the national bourse regulator CMVM on March 26, 2008.

The substantial appreciation of the euro against the currencies of almost all countries where Cimpor operates and the 25 per cent rise in the fuel prices on average affected considerably the company’s operating profit during the whole year. However, the extension of its consolidation perimeter, mainly resulting from the inclusion of new business areas such as Turkey and China, drove Cimpor’s 2007 EBITDA up to a record high EUR607m, up 7.8 per cent.
